如何高效地搭建富阳地区的安卓软件?—一篇关于富阳安卓软件高级搭建的指南

作者: 西峡县纯量网络阅读:70 次发布时间:2023-09-09 19:35:56

摘要:本文旨在探讨如何高效地搭建富阳地区的安卓软件。通过对开发环境的搭建、技术选型、代码优化、测试与发布、用户反馈等方面的详细介绍,帮助读者系统地了解安卓软件的开发流程,提升开发效率,最终实现用户满意度的提升。1. 开发环境的搭建 在搭建安卓开发环境时,需要安装开发工具、测试工具以及相关的插件...

  本文旨在探讨如何高效地搭建富阳地区的安卓软件。通过对开发环境的搭建、技术选型、代码优化、测试与发布、用户反馈等方面的详细介绍,帮助读者系统地了解安卓软件的开发流程,提升开发效率,最终实现用户满意度的提升。

如何高效地搭建富阳地区的安卓软件?—一篇关于富阳安卓软件高级搭建的指南

  1. 开发环境的搭建

  在搭建安卓开发环境时,需要安装开发工具、测试工具以及相关的插件。推荐使用Android Studio开发工具,它内置了Android SDK和Gradle构建工具,可通过其提供的插件来进行调试、构建和发布等方面的操作。还应当安装适当的模拟器和测试工具,以验证软件在不同设备上的兼容性。

  2. 技术选型

  在技术选型方面,应根据项目需求和开发周期等综合考虑,如开发语言、数据库、框架等的选择。对于开发语言而言,可以选择Java或Kotlin,前者是安卓开发的主流语言,而后者则更加简洁高效。对于数据库的选择,建议使用SQLite作为本地持久化存储的方案,同时可以考虑使用云服务来存储部分数据。在框架的选择方面,可以选择MVP或MVVM架构,来分离业务逻辑与界面展示。

  3. 代码优化

  代码优化方面,应当关注可维护性、稳定性以及性能优化。针对可维护性,建议使用代码规范和注释等方式保持代码清晰、易懂。对于稳定性而言,需要针对各种场景进行异常判断和处理。对于性能优化方面,需要关注布局优化、图片压缩、网络请求等方面的优化,以提升应用的启动速度和响应速度,提升用户体验。

  4. 测试与发布

  测试阶段是整个开发流程中非常关键的一步,需要开展集成测试、UI测试、功能测试等多种测试,保证软件的稳定性和兼容性,提前发现并解决可能出现的问题。在发布方面,需要对应用进行签名和打包,准备应用图标、应用名、截图、应用描述等信息,并上架至应用商店。

  5. 用户反馈

  在软件上线后,需要积极收集用户反馈,通过用户反馈不断完善软件,提高用户体验。还需要关注应用的用户评分和下载量等指标,针对问题进行迭代和升级,不断优化软件。

  本文通过对安卓软件开发过程中的关键步骤进行详细介绍,为读者提供了一套完整的指南,帮助其高效搭建富阳地区的安卓软件。在开发过程中,我们需要关注用户需求,坚持代码优化、测试和用户反馈的三大环节,不断优化软件,提高用户体验,才能不断提升软件的品质和价值。

  随着信息技术的快速发展,软件开发成为了人们的重要需求之一。在这个时代,安卓应用已成为人们生活中不可或缺的一部分。在富阳地区,随着技术的发展,人们对于安卓应用的需求也越来越多。本文将从如何高效地搭建富阳地区的安卓软件方面进行探讨,为读者提供一份关于富阳安卓软件高级搭建的指南。

  1. 寻找适合的开发工具

  在搭建富阳地区的安卓软件之前,我们需要先选择一款适合的开发工具。不同的开发工具拥有各自的优缺点,我们应该根据我们的需求和实际情况来选择。在选择开发工具时,我们应该考虑以下因素:

  (1)开发工具的易用性:选择一款易用性较高的开发工具可以让我们快速地了解软件开发的流程和方法。

  (2)开发工具的功能:不同的开发工具功能不尽相同,我们需要根据自己的需求选择可以满足我们所有需求的开发工具。

  (3)开发工具的兼容性:我们在选择开发工具时,还需要考虑工具的兼容性。在开发过程中,我们可能需要使用其他工具和插件来辅助开发,因此我们需要选择兼容性较好的工具。

  2. 设计合适的界面

  安卓软件的成功离不开一个好的界面设计。当我们开始设计界面时,我们需要考虑以下几点:

  (1)界面的风格:我们需要根据软件的功能和目的来为软件设计出适合的风格。例如,对于游戏应用,我们可以设计出更加有趣、可爱的界面;而对于商务应用,我们则需要设计出更加简洁、专业的界面。

  (2)界面的排版:在界面设计中,排版是关键。我们需要让界面中的各个元素能够有条理、更加清晰明了。

  (3)界面的交互:在界面设计中,交互是不可或缺的一部分。我们需要考虑用户的各种操作,包括滑动、点击等,来优化用户体验。

  3. 合理规划软件架构

  在设计富阳地区的安卓软件时,我们需要考虑软件的架构问题。一个好的软件架构可以让我们更好地处理软件中的各项任务。不同的软件架构有着不同的优缺点,我们需要根据自己的需求和实际情况来选择。

  (1)Model-View-Controller(MVC)模式:这种模式将应用程序的数据、界面和控制器相分离,并且使它们各自的修改不会影响到其他部分。

  (2)Model-View-ViewModel(MVVM)模式:这种模式与MVC相似,但将View和ViewModel合并,把Controller替换为ViewModel。

  (3)Model-View-Presenter(MVP)模式:这种模式也是将应用程序的数据、界面和控制器分离,但这个分离是用Presenter取代现有的Controller来完成的。

  4. 不断优化软件性能

  富阳地区的安卓软件开发成功之后,我们还需要不断地优化软件的性能,以达到更加出色的用户体验。在优化软件性能时,我们可以采取以下措施:

  (1)压缩图片与文件:压缩图片与文件可以提高软件的加载速度,优化用户体验。

  (2)优化代码:使用正确的代码方法可以减轻系统负担,提高软件运行效率。

  (3)去除不必要的操作:减少不必要的计算和操作可以有效减少软件的负载,提高软件的运行效率。

  5. 加强软件的安全

  最后,我们需要加强软件的安全。当我们的软件面临黑客攻击和其他安全问题时,这些安全问题可能导致我们的应用程序崩溃或失效。

  (1)使用HTTPS:使用HTTPS可以保护我们的软件用户和数据的安全。

  (2)保护用户信息:不要暴露用户的信息,保护用户的隐私。

  (3)使用最新的安全协议:使用最新的安全协议可以保护我们的软件免受安全漏洞和其他威胁的攻击。

  本文针对富阳地区的安卓软件的高级搭建问题进行了探讨。在本文中,我们介绍了如何选择适合的开发工具、设计合适的界面、合理规划软件架构、不断优化软件性能以及加强软件的安全。希望这篇文章能够为富阳地区的安卓软件开发者提供一些有用的参考。

  • 原标题:如何高效地搭建富阳地区的安卓软件?—一篇关于富阳安卓软件高级搭建的指南

  • 本文由 西峡县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部